2020 CRC to ETB Performance & Market Timing Review

Analysis of key historical highlights and timing insights for 2020

During 2020, the CRC to ETB exchange rate experienced significant fluctuation. The market reached its absolute peak on December 25, valuing the pair at 0.0645. Conversely, the yearly low was recorded on January 13, dropping to 0.0558.

This high-to-low spread represents a total annual volatility of 0.0087 ETB. From a start-to-finish perspective, comparing the January average rate of 0.0564 to the December average rate of 0.0639, the exchange rate registered a net change of 13.35% (reflecting a strengthening trend).

Looking at year-over-year peak valuations, the 2020 high of 0.0645 was up 14.61% compared to the 2019 peak of 0.0563, indicating shifts in long-term support levels.
